Arborist is the musical moniker of Belfast-based Mark McCambridge. Across three critically acclaimed albums, Mark has honed a unique ambient-folk sound.
His third album 'An Endless Sequence of Dead Zeros’, recorded at Spacebomb Studios in Virginia, won the Northern Ireland Music Prize.
His spine-tingling ballads and playful lyricism have attracted esteemed fans - Arborist has collaborated with Kim Deal (Pixies, The Breeders) and shared a bill with the likes of Public Service Broadcasting, James Yorkston and The Delines.
In 2025, he recorded the stunning track - ‘Are You Still The King?’ - for a ‘ghost of Elvis’-themed compilation album curated by Bill Drummond (The KLF).
The Trades Club gig is a rare English date for Arborist, who is releasing a new album in 2026.

Arborist are a Belfast-based band; the product of the musical and lyrical misadventures of Mark McCambridge, surrounded by a cast of accomplished and well-travelled musicians including Richard Hill, James Heaney, Ben McAuley, Johnny Ashe and Luke Bannon. They have built up a solid following around Ireland and beyond since 2013 with EP releases, tours and support slots with the likes of Low, Cat Power and British Sea Power.
